Tallahassee (Florida)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Salt Lake City (UT rate: 4.7%).

Is $100K a good salary in Tallahassee?

At $100K/year in Tallahassee, your estimated monthly take-home is $6,321. With 1BR rent around $1,350/month, rent takes up 21% of your take-home. That's considered very comfortable.

Is $100K a good salary in Salt Lake City?

At $100K/year in Salt Lake City, your estimated monthly take-home is $5,929. With 1BR rent around $1,700/month, rent takes up 29% of your take-home. That's considered manageable.

Which city is more affordable on a $100K salary?

Tallahassee le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$4,314/month vs $3,557/month in Salt Lake City.

Can I afford to live alone in Tallahassee on $100K?

Yes. At $100K in Tallahassee, rent takes 21% of your take-home, leaving $4,314/month after essentials. Most financial planners recommend keeping rent below 30%.
